MercadoLibre, Inc. (NASDAQ:MELI) Shares Purchased by New York State Common Retirement Fund

New York State Common Retirement Fund boosted its position in MercadoLibre, Inc. (NASDAQ:MELIFree Report) by 20.6% during the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The fund owned 34,217 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 5,843 shares during the quarter. New York State Common Retirement Fund’s holdings in MercadoLibre were worth $58,184,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

MercadoLibre Company Profile

(Free Report)

MercadoLibre, Inc operates online commerce platforms in the United States. It operates Mercado Libre Marketplace, an automated online commerce platform that enables businesses, merchants, and individuals to list merchandise and conduct sales and purchases digitally; and Mercado Pago FinTech platform, a financial technology solution platform, which facilitates transactions on and off its marketplaces by providing a mechanism that allows its users to send and receive payments online, as well as allows users to transfer money through their websites or on the apps.
